Add To Cart‘Pinkerton’ is a stunning Japanese iris with large, 7-inch soft pink blooms accented by dark veining, rippled edges, and graceful pink crests. Blooming later than many other irises, it extends the season with impressive flowers that make excellent accents along ponds, water gardens, and moist landscape beds.

Growing Tips for Iris ensata ''Pinkerton''
Keep the soil consistently moist for the best growth and flowering. It performs well near ponds or streams and thrives in full sun to partial shade. Add fertilizer to the soil a month or two before planting the Japanese Irises. Once established, fertilize them in early spring and again right after they are finished blooming.
